    That doesn't affect the Rockets. If the Rockets trade Asik tomorrow, he counts $8.3mil for trade matching purposes. Even if the team trading for him will be paying him ~$2mil this year(whatever % of games left/$5mil), $5mil next year, and $15mil in his 3rd year. For the new team, the cap is still 8.3/8.3/8.3.
